DUDEK v. U. M. W.

No. 34294.

164 Ohio St. 227 (1955)

DUDEK, D. B. A. JOE DUDEK COAL MINING CO., APPELLANT, v. UNITED MINE WORKERS OF AMERICA ET AL., APPELLEES.

Supreme Court of Ohio.

Decided October 26, 1955.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Messrs. Thornburg & Lewis, for appellant.

Mr. George T. Tarbutton, for appellees.


Per Curiam.

When this court refused to dismiss this appeal, holding that a debatable constitutional question was involved, it recognized that the questions of law involved were similar to those involved in the then pending case of Grimes & Hauer, Inc., v. Pollock, 163 Ohio St. 372, 127 N.E.2d 203, and it is unfortunate that the two cases were not assigned for hearing at the same time.
